660MM stringing blocks are used for stringing medium size conductor (26-31 mm) in overhead transmission line construction.The sheaves of stringing block are made of aluminum alloy lined with neoprene or high strength MC nylon. All the sheaves are mounted on ball bearings. The frame of block is made of galvanized steel.
3. Data Sheet
Item No. | Model | Quantity of sheaves | Working Load (KN) | Weight (kg) | Material of sheaves |
10121 | SHD660 | 1 | 20 | 30 | Aluminum wheel lined with neoprene |
10122 | SHS660 | 3 | 40 | 106 | Central wheel steel, sides aluminum wheels lined with neoprene |
10123 | SHW660 | 5 | 60 | 150 | |
10124 | SHDN660 | 1 | 20 | 24 | MC nylon sheave |
10125 | SHSLN660 | 3 | 40 | 92 | Central steel sheave, sides aluminum sheaves lined with neoprene |
10126 | SHWLN660 | 5 | 60 | 120 | |
10127 | SHSQN660 | 3 | 40 | 76 | All the sheaves are made of MC nylon |
10128 | SHWQN660 | 5 | 60 | 110 | |
10129 | SHQZ660 | 7 | 80 | 268 | Central steel sheave, sides aluminum sheaves lined with neoprene |
10130 | SHQ660A | 7 | 75 | 190 | Central steel sheave, sides sheaves in MC nylon |
It is normally used for conductor from 25-31 mm.
The sheave size: (outer dia. X inner dia. X width: Φ660 x Φ560 x 100 mm.
The steel sheave width: 90 mm.
